Video Summary
This webinar explored how to define and build online influence, especially on LinkedIn. Hosted by Tom Liversedge from the APS, the session featured influencer marketing expert Gordon Glenister and B2B LinkedIn specialist Alex Galvez. Alex shared her journey from corporate finance to becoming a leading LinkedIn creator, explaining how a vulnerable post about leaving her job and redefining success helped launch her personal brand. She stressed that authenticity, consistency, and storytelling are the most powerful tools for influence online.<br /><br />The discussion covered why people follow others on social media, with the poll showing that education and added value mattered most, followed by personal connections. Alex and Gordon agreed that LinkedIn content performs best when it tells a personal story while offering insight or value. They also discussed branding consistency across platforms, the importance of a well-optimized LinkedIn profile, and the role of keywords and hashtags in being discovered.<br /><br />Other topics included tagging etiquette, engagement in the first 15 minutes of posting, the limited effectiveness of generic motivational quotes, and how businesses should trust employees to share their voices. The session ended with practical advice for newcomers, especially students and professionals, to start early, stay consistent, and use LinkedIn as a long-term tool for career growth and relationship building.
